1

Computer Programmer Jobs in Baton Rouge, LA (NOW HIRING)

Embedded Firmware Engineer

Baton Rouge, LA ยท On-site

$80.80K - $110.70K/yr

Bachelor's degree in Electrical Engineering, Computer Engineering, Computer Science, or related field * Professional experience developing embedded firmware in C/C++ * Experience with real-time or ...

Azure Cloud Engineer

Baton Rouge, LA ยท On-site

$120K - $160K/yr

Bachelor's degree in computer science, information systems, computer engineering or related field; or an equivalent combination of education and experience. * Foundational Azure certifications e.g.

Electrical / Computer Engineering or Control Systems. Work Visas * Must have authorization to work in the United States for this position. Offered Benefits * 401(k) * Medical, dental, and vision ...

The Engineer will be responsible for tasks related to calculations, structural analysis, structural and civil engineering, and computer-aided design (CAD). The role is located in Baton Rouge, LA with ...

Senior Bridge Engineer

Baton Rouge, LA ยท On-site

$87.90K - $119.40K/yr

Must be able to sit and operate a computer for extended periods * Travel required to support projects (as needed) About Thompson Engineering Founded in 1953, Thompson Engineering has a longstanding ...

Senior Bridge Engineer

Baton Rouge, LA ยท On-site

$87.90K - $119.40K/yr

Must be able to sit and operate a computer for extended periods * Travel required to support projects (as needed) About Thompson Engineering Founded in 1953, Thompson Engineering has a longstanding ...

Senior Bridge Engineer

Baton Rouge, LA

$87.90K - $119.40K/yr

Must be able to sit and operate a computer for extended periods * Travel required to support projects (as needed) About Thompson Engineering Founded in 1953, Thompson Engineering has a longstanding ...

Senior Bridge Engineer

Baton Rouge, LA

$87.90K - $119.40K/yr

Must be able to sit and operate a computer for extended periods * Travel required to support projects (as needed) About Thompson Engineering Founded in 1953, Thompson Engineering has a longstanding ...

next page

Showing results 1-20

Computer Programmer information

See Baton Rouge, LA salary details

$28.5K

$56.1K

$82.5K

How much do computer programmer jobs pay per year?

As of May 30, 2026, the average yearly pay for computer programmer in Baton Rouge, LA is $56,143.00, according to ZipRecruiter salary data. Most workers in this role earn between $43,600.00 and $69,100.00 per year, depending on experience, location, and employer.

What Does a Computer Programmer Do?

A computer programmer designs, tests, writes, debugs, and maintains the computer program code. The coding language is written for the computer to be able to comprehend it and take specific actions according to those commands. Computer programmers can work with existing code or create something entirely new. The objective of coding is to develop programs that act on specific controls and behaviors. Coders need to be able to work with specialized algorithms, logic, and app domain, as well. But the other key goal of a computer programmer is to design interfaces that regular non-technical users can easily understand and use.

What are the key skills and qualifications needed to thrive as a Computer Programmer, and why are they important?

To thrive as a Computer Programmer, you need strong proficiency in programming languages (such as Python, Java, or C++), problem-solving skills, and a relevant degree or equivalent experience. Familiarity with software development tools, version control systems like Git, and sometimes certifications in specific languages or frameworks are commonly required. Attention to detail, communication skills, and the ability to work both independently and collaboratively are standout soft skills in this field. These competencies ensure high-quality, efficient code development and effective teamwork in rapidly evolving technical environments.

What are some typical challenges computer programmers face when working on large team projects?

Computer programmers working on large team projects often encounter challenges such as coordinating code changes, maintaining consistent coding standards, and managing dependencies between different components. Effective communication and the use of version control systems like Git are essential to prevent conflicts and ensure smooth collaboration. Additionally, programmers must often adapt to varying coding styles and workflows, making flexibility and a collaborative mindset important for success in team environments.

What are computer programmers?

Computer programmers are professionals who write, test, and maintain the code that allows software programs and applications to function. They translate designs and instructions created by software engineers or developers into logical sequences that computers can follow. Programmers use various programming languages, such as Python, Java, or C++, to create and troubleshoot software to ensure it runs smoothly. Their work is essential to the development of websites, apps, operating systems, and a wide range of digital tools.

What is the difference between Computer Programmer vs Software Developer?

AspectComputer ProgrammerSoftware Developer
CredentialsTypically requires a bachelor's degree in computer science or related fieldUsually requires a bachelor's degree, often with additional experience or certifications
Work EnvironmentOften works in coding, debugging, and maintaining softwareDesigns, develops, tests, and maintains software applications
Industry UsageCommonly employed in IT, software firms, and tech departmentsFound in a wide range of industries including tech, finance, healthcare

While both roles involve coding and software creation, Computer Programmers primarily focus on writing and debugging code based on specifications, whereas Software Developers are involved in designing and building complete software solutions. The roles often overlap, but Developers typically have broader responsibilities in the software development lifecycle.

What are the most commonly searched types of Computer Programmer jobs in Baton Rouge, LA? The most popular types of Computer Programmer jobs in Baton Rouge, LA are:
What are popular job titles related to Computer Programmer jobs in Baton Rouge, LA? For Computer Programmer jobs in Baton Rouge, LA, the most frequently searched job titles are:
What job categories do people searching Computer Programmer jobs in Baton Rouge, LA look for? The top searched job categories for Computer Programmer jobs in Baton Rouge, LA are:
What cities near Baton Rouge, LA are hiring for Computer Programmer jobs? Cities near Baton Rouge, LA with the most Computer Programmer job openings:
Embedded Firmware Engineer

Embedded Firmware Engineer

TRUCE Software

Baton Rouge, LA โ€ข On-site

$80.80K - $110.70K/yr

Full-time

Posted 10 days ago


Job description

About TRUCE Software
TRUCE Software is the leading provider of workplace and fleet safety solutions. Our software automatically manages mobile device usage, helping organizations reduce distractions, improve compliance, and create safer workplaces.
About the Role
We are expanding our Baton Rouge engineering team to support development of next-generation TRUCE products, including a custom dash camera platform. This role is ideal for an embedded engineer who enjoys working close to hardware and defining systems from the ground up. Because this position involves hands-on board bring-up, hardware debugging, and lab-based validation, regular in-office collaboration is expected. Remote flexibility is available when lab presence is not required.
You will work across embedded firmware, wireless communication (Wi-Fi and Bluetooth), camera systems, and on-device machine learning while owning firmware quality, validation strategy, and long-term reliability.
What You'll Work On
  • Design and implement embedded firmware for custom dash camera platforms
  • Develop multimedia pipelines including RTSP streaming and SD card storage
  • Integrate and configure camera sensors for capture and tuning
  • Develop and maintain wireless communication (Wi-Fi, Wi-Fi Aware/NAN, Bluetooth)
  • Enable execution of pretrained ML inference models on embedded hardware
  • Optimize firmware for performance, memory, power, and long-duration stability
  • Bring up and debug new hardware in collaboration with the electrical engineering team
  • Contribute to firmware architecture and long-term platform strategy

Validation & Testing Ownership
  • Develop structured test plans and detailed test cases
  • Execute system-level validation across video, storage, wireless, and ML subsystems
  • Build automated regression and test tooling (Python or similar)
  • Develop hardware-in-the-loop (HIL) or bench-level test environments
  • Support manufacturing test and production firmware validation
  • Investigate field failures and implement corrective actions

Why This Role
  • Own firmware for a new hardware platform from early development through production
  • Direct access to hardware labs for rapid iteration
  • Work on a product combining embedded systems, video, wireless, and ML
  • Influence architecture and validation strategy early
  • Small, high-impact engineering team
  • Real-world safety product with measurable impact

Requirements
Required Qualifications
  • Bachelor's degree in Electrical Engineering, Computer Engineering, Computer Science, or related field
  • Professional experience developing embedded firmware in C/C++
  • Experience with real-time or resource-constrained systems
  • Experience interfacing with hardware peripherals (SPI, I2C, UART, etc.)
  • Strong debugging skills at the firmware / hardware boundary
  • Experience developing structured test plans and system-level validation
  • Ability to work onsite in Baton Rouge on a regular basis

Preferred Experience
  • Wi-Fi and/or Bluetooth experience in embedded systems
  • RTSP, video streaming, or multimedia pipeline experience
  • Camera module or image sensor integration
  • SD card interfaces and embedded file systems
  • Machine-learning inference deployment on embedded devices
  • RTOS or bare-metal systems
  • Python for tooling, automation, or testing
  • Experience supporting product validation or manufacturing test

*Must be available for in-person interviews.